Halo: The Fall of Reach Launch Trailer Showcases Master Chief’s Origin
October not only sees the long-awaited release of Halo 5: Guardians, but also a new CG animated Halo movie. This one is particular is an animated adaptation of Eric Nylund’s Halo: The Fall of Reach novel. You can check out the new launch trailer for the film that was recently released by Microsoft and 343 Industries below.
The animated feature is included with the upcoming Limited Edition release of Halo 5: Guardians. The story features the origin of the Spartan program and the origin of the legendary hero of the franchise, Master Chief. As a child, he’s conscripted into a brutal military training and augmentation program. The Spartans are designed to be the ultimate weapon against chaos and insurgency. However, the alien alliance called The Covenant soon declares war on humanity, and the Spartans may be mankind’s only hope. The book was previously published in 2001, but it’s nice to see a film that will provide a visual narrative for Master Chief’s origin. This is especially since it seems that Steven Spielberg’s Halo TV series is on the back-burner and not going to meet its originally projected 2015 release date, and it seems like it will not see the light of day for the foreseeable future.
Halo 5: The Fall of Reach is due out with the Halo 5: Guardians Limited Edition release on October 27. The game will be available exclusively on Xbox One.
